
Households looking for sensory-friendly experiences don’t should journey far to get them.
Quite a few locations within the Akron-Canton space supply actions, rooms and experiences for company with a sensory, social or studying incapacity, whose brains turn into overwhelmed by stimulation.
Almost one in six People have or will expertise a sensory or communication dysfunction of their lifetime, the U.S. Workplace of Illness Prevention and Well being Promotion reported.
“Sensory-friendly workplaces and different websites acknowledge that people might be impacted by sound, sight, contact and scent and style, and may profit from changes and modifications,” stated Kevin Miller, director of Alternatives for Ohioans with Disabilities.
For instance, the Massillon Museum added a sensory room when it expanded in 2018-19 for patrons who want a break from overstimulation. It adopted the success of a 2017 multi-sensory exhibition referred to as “Blind Spot.”

Stephanie Toole, museum schooling and outreach supervisor, stated the exhibition made work accessible to individuals with blindness and low imaginative and prescient. The paintings had tactile or contact capabilities, plus Braille labels.

From that have, Toole stated the museum expanded its sensory-friendly capabilities for patrons with different disabilities.
“A part of our mission is to make artwork and historical past accessible to everybody,” she stated.
Toole stated the museum sensory room is out there upon request on the entrance desk and is free to make use of. Any patron can use the room however it was created for “people with sensory sensitivities” in thoughts, she stated.
The room consists of adjustable lights and tactile and weighted assets. Like different amenities, together with the Akron Rubberducks, the museum has sensory luggage for patrons.
A sensory bag can embrace headphones to dam out noise, fidget toys, sun shades to scale back lights and visible playing cards for youngsters to verbalize with others.
“We now have people who come right here as a result of they’ve heard concerning the sensory room,” Toole stated. “It will get used each day.”
